In today's data-driven world, integrating user behavior analytics with comprehensive data storage solutions is essential for advanced reporting and decision-making. Heap, a popular product analytics tool, offers detailed insights into user interactions. Connecting Heap with data warehouses allows organizations to perform in-depth analysis, create custom reports, and improve business strategies.

Understanding the Benefits of Integration

Integrating Heap with data warehouses enhances data accessibility and analysis capabilities. It enables teams to:

  • Consolidate data from multiple sources
  • Perform complex queries and analysis
  • Create customized dashboards and reports
  • Improve data accuracy and consistency
  • Support advanced machine learning models

Several data warehouse platforms are compatible with Heap, including:

  • Amazon Redshift
  • Google BigQuery
  • Snowflake
  • Azure Synapse Analytics

Steps to Connect Heap with Data Warehouses

Establishing a connection involves several key steps to ensure seamless data flow and security.

1. Choose Your Data Warehouse Platform

Select the data warehouse that best fits your organizational needs based on scalability, cost, and compatibility.

2. Set Up Data Export in Heap

Heap offers native integrations and APIs to export data. Configure data export settings to include relevant event data, user properties, and custom attributes.

3. Use ETL Tools or Connectors

Utilize Extract, Transform, Load (ETL) tools such as Fivetran, Stitch, or custom scripts to automate data transfer from Heap to your data warehouse. Many ETL providers offer pre-built connectors for Heap.

4. Configure Data Loading and Transformation

Set up data pipelines to load data into your warehouse regularly. Apply necessary transformations to optimize data for analysis and reporting.

Best Practices for Maintaining Data Integration

Ensure the ongoing success of your data integration by following these best practices:

  • Automate data synchronization to prevent delays
  • Monitor data pipelines for errors and performance issues
  • Secure sensitive data during transfer and storage
  • Regularly update and optimize ETL processes
  • Validate data accuracy and completeness periodically

Conclusion

Connecting Heap with data warehouses unlocks powerful insights that can drive strategic decisions. By following the outlined steps and best practices, organizations can streamline their data workflows, enhance reporting capabilities, and gain a competitive edge in their industry.